Size: a a a

2020 June 02

AN

Anton Noginov in nginx_ru
И гавкается-то оно на какую конкретно переменную?
источник

w

wolfich in nginx_ru
да на любую вида ngx.var.*
источник

w

wolfich in nginx_ru
я уже грешу на docker. может, он как-то не дает обращаться к переменным nginx?
источник

AN

Anton Noginov in nginx_ru
Нет. Но он может быть причиной, что в http_host приезжает говно.

Влепите туда первой строкой
ngx.log(ngx.ERR, ngx.var.http_host)

- чо будет?
источник

w

wolfich in nginx_ru
ничего нового. я правильно понимаю, что оно должно было в error.log писать?
источник

AN

Anton Noginov in nginx_ru
Да

Херня какая-то.

А что за nginx, что за lua?
источник

w

wolfich in nginx_ru
lua 5.1
nginx/1.18.0
источник

AN

Anton Noginov in nginx_ru
Эм.
Там же luajit, а он в районе 2.х пока?
Ванильный? Не resty/прочее?
источник

w

wolfich in nginx_ru
да, не туда глянул. минут через 5 скину
источник

w

wolfich in nginx_ru
LUA_MODULE_VERSION=0.10.16rc5
источник

w

wolfich in nginx_ru
оно?
источник

w

wolfich in nginx_ru
luajit-2.1
источник

AN

Anton Noginov in nginx_ru
Не совсем оно, но оно.
Короче. С 0.10.15 оно вроде как принципе перестало работать с ванильным luajit - только с пропатченым openresty.

nginx -v что говорит?

Если это патченый jit и openresty со всем ворохом левых модулей развешанных по хэндлерам - там что угодном может быть.
источник

w

wolfich in nginx_ru
Ок. Попробую на openresty собрать
источник

w

wolfich in nginx_ru
Благодарю
источник

AN

Anton Noginov in nginx_ru
На всякий случай.
    location / {
      set $ups '' ;
      rewrite_by_lua_block {
        ngx.var.ups="ya.ru"
      }
      add_header Ups $ups ;
      proxy_pass http://$ups ;
   }


Вот это у меня сейчас одинаково отработало как на старом nginx/ванильный jit, так и на последнем openresty :-/
источник
2020 June 03

NP

Nicolai Petrov in nginx_ru
Привет всем.  
Кто собирал у кого работает модуль    nginx_mod_ct ??  Для nginx 1.19  ???
источник

NP

Nicolai Petrov in nginx_ru
У меня вываливается segfault
источник

NP

Nicolai Petrov in nginx_ru
При этом всё тоже самое с nginx 1.17.10 РАБОТАЕТ
источник

P

Pavel in nginx_ru
Anton Noginov
Если /api/getList вчера занимал 5ms, а сегодня 15 - то что-то происходит.
Если в бэке трейсер проблем не показывает - и при этом recv-q растет - то воркеров нехватает
если у тебя 40 апрстримов, отвечающих в дапазоне от 3 мс до 70мс, в зависимости от сложности запроса, текущей нагрузки на сеть итд, смотреть на температуру по борльнице не эффективно.

тренд увидеть можно столько когда оно прямо СОВСЕМ явно будет
источник